Rotary drilling bits are usually classified as drag bits or rolling cutter bits according to their design. All drag bits consist of fixed cutter blades that are integral to the body of the bit and rotate as a unit with the drill string. This type of drilling bits dates back to the introduction of the rotary drilling process in the 19th century.. .

The penetration rate that can be achieved by a bit has an inverse effect on the drilling cost per foot. The main factors that affect the penetration rate are 1. bit type 2. formation properties 3. drilling fluid properties 4. bit weight and rotary speed 5. bit hydraulics
